Subject: [PATCH] Add more debugging support and fix tests for compatibility
with wolfSSL
Tested against Nginx versions:
- 1.21.4
Changes made:
- Show log location
- Add gdbserver and valgrind support
- Different ports for different certs
- ssl_certificates.t
- ssl_ocsp.t
- ssl_stapling.t
- Fix ssl_verify_depth.t test. To be able to generate intermediate certs without the keyUsage extension, wolfSSL needs to be compiled with `ALLOW_INVALID_CERTSIGN`. Otherwise such intermediate certs will be rejected.
